First of all, the biggest feature of the British White Cliff is its white appearance. These cliffs are made of chalk, and from a distance, they look like a white canvas stretching across the coastline.


When the sun shines on the white cliffs, they seem to emit a mysterious light, giving people an amazing sight. This pristine appearance has made the English White Cliffs a source of inspiration for many artists and photographers who have permanently imprinted their beauty in their works of art through painting and photography.

In addition, the British White Cliffs is also an ecological treasure trove, with a rich variety of flora and fauna. In the crevices of these cliffs, there are many rare plants, which tenaciously survive in the wind and sun.


Holes in the cliffs and meadows on the cliffs provide habitat for seabirds, including gulls, terns, and puffins. In summer, there will be thousands of seabirds nesting on the cliffs and multiplying their offspring, bringing a vibrant picture to people.

If you're planning a trip to White Cliffs, England, here's a travel guide to help you get the most out of this stunning place.


1. Choose the best time: Although White Cliffs is open all year round, the best time is in spring and summer. At this time, the weather is warmer, the plants on the cliffs are more luxurious, and the seabirds are more active. Avoid going during winter or rainy season, as the weather is cold and maybe rainy, which will affect the sightseeing experience.


2. Sightseeing route: After arriving at the White Cliff in England, you can choose to walk or ride a bicycle along the path on the top of the cliff for sightseeing. There are two main routes to choose from: East Side and West Side.


The route on the east side is shorter but still offers stunning scenery. While the west side of the route is longer, providing more viewpoints and wider sea views.


3. Visit beautiful lighthouses: On the sightseeing route on the west side, you will encounter many historic lighthouses. The most famous of these is South Foreland Lighthouse, one of the oldest working lighthouses in the UK. You can take a tour of the lighthouse and learn about its history and how it works.


4. Admire the magnificent scenery: During the journey, don't forget to stop and enjoy the magnificent scenery. The top of the White Cliffs offers expansive sea views overlooking the English Channel and the opposite French coastline. In addition, you can also watch the spectacular scene of seabirds flying and perching on the cliff.


5. Protect the environment: As a natural wonder, it is very important to protect the environment. Please try not to litter and keep it tidy. At the same time, follow local environmental protection regulations and respect the living space of plants and animals.
